American exchanges fell more than 3% on WHO data on coronavirus

Major US stock indexes fell more than 3% due to concerns about the spread coronavirus. Dow Jones at close of trading lost 3.56%, S&P 500 - 3.35%, NASDAQ - 3.71% (during the trading session, the the latter reached 4%). The collapse was provoked by the news from the World Organization health care. According to her, on February 24, the number of new cases of infection exceeded 2 thousand, while 29 countries. Such a scale has increased the concern of players the impact of the epidemic on global economic growth and the Chinese economy. According to the expert of the Center for Strategic and International US Research (SCIS) Scott McDonald, stock market crash due to the fact that investors underestimated the importance of the virus for global GDP, and the level of uncertainty around the future the development of the situation is quite high. The PRC economy received huge damage, McDonald noticed, and the timing of its recovery unknown ..
